The cheapest way to get from London to Barfleur is to bus and ferry which costs €45 - €100 and takes 13h 50m.
The fastest way to get from London to Barfleur is to drive and Eurotunnel which takes 6h 33m and costs €220 - €280.
No, there is no direct train from London to Barfleur. However, there are services departing from London St Pancras Intl and arriving at Valognes via Paris St Lazare.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 7h 47m.
The distance between London and Barfleur is 325 km.
